The right size depends on your specific project scope and debris type. A 10-yard container handles most small bathroom renovations or deck replacements, holding about 3-4 pickup truck loads. For kitchen remodels or room additions, a 20-yard container typically works best, accommodating 7-8 truck loads.
Larger projects like whole-house renovations or new construction usually require 30-yard or 40-yard containers. Here’s the key: Fire Island’s construction materials often include heavy items like cedar siding and composite decking, which can hit weight limits faster than volume limits.
We’ll discuss your project details and recommend the optimal size to avoid overage fees while ensuring you have adequate capacity for your timeline.

Most construction and renovation debris is accepted, including wood, drywall, roofing materials, siding, flooring, and general household items. Fire Island projects often generate cedar siding, composite decking, and coastal construction materials—all acceptable for standard disposal.
However, hazardous materials like paint, chemicals, asbestos, and certain electronics require special handling and cannot go in regular dumpsters. Same goes for items like tires, batteries, and appliances containing refrigerants.
If you’re unsure about specific materials from your Fire Island project, just ask. We’ll clarify what’s acceptable and help you arrange proper disposal for any restricted items, ensuring your project stays compliant with local regulations.
Pricing depends on container size, rental duration, and debris type. Small 10-yard containers typically range from $300-450 for a week, while popular 20-yard units run $400-550. Larger 30-yard containers usually cost $500-650 for residential projects.
Fire Island’s location may affect pricing due to delivery logistics, but we provide transparent, upfront quotes with all costs included. No surprise fees, no hidden charges—you’ll know exactly what you’re paying before we deliver.
